'Protection of cardholder data in top priority for visa customers'

New Delhi, Jun 30 (UNI) Visa Asia Pacific's Risk Management Conference 2006 in Singapore in its research report has revealed that protecting cardholder data is top priority for businessmen in India from across the Asia Pacific region.

The research was conducted among 279 merchants in 11 markets across Asia Pacific, including India, between April and May.

Paricipants in the survey considered that the protection of cardholder data was their biggest concern, with as much as 78 per cent having this opinion.

Payment card fraud came in as the second biggest area of concern (63 per cent) while identity theft was the third major concern (61 per cent).

The research carried out quantitative interviews which were conducted by Harris Interactive between April 20 and May 26, 2006 in 11 markets across Asia Pacific.

Visa has a greater market share in Asia Pacific region than all other payment card brands combined with 62 per cent of all card purchases.

There are currently 287 million Visa-branded cards in the region.
